Chas, do you have your carbs ganged so that both are always in sync and open to the same degree? It seems so from your photo. If so, I can guess that running them a bit lean is in order. But if I use the original type linkage, they will open in sequence and prior to the second carb opening, I would think that the first 600 CFM carb would be about correct. Am I thinking about this correctly? If ganging them is preferable, what are the advantages? Bill
